+class Node(object):
+
+    def __init__(self, clear_text=True, **kwargs):
+        if clear_text:
+            enc = CryptoEngine.get()
+            self._username = enc.encrypt(kwargs.get('username')).strip()
+            self._password = enc.encrypt(kwargs.get('password')).strip()
+            self._url = enc.encrypt(kwargs.get('url')).strip()
+            self._notes = enc.encrypt(kwargs.get('notes')).strip()
+            self._tags = [enc.encrypt(t).strip() for t in kwargs.get('tags')]
+
+    @classmethod
+    def from_encrypted_entries(cls, username, password, url, notes, tags):
+        """
+        We use this alternatively, to create a node instance when reading
+        the encrypted entities from the database
+        """
+        node = Node(clear_text=False)
+        node._username = username.strip()
+        node._password = password.strip()
+        node._url = url.strip()
+        node._notes = notes.strip()
+        node._tags = [t.strip() for t in tags]
+        return node
+
+    @property
+    def password(self):
+        """Get the current password."""
+        enc = CryptoEngine.get()
+        return enc.decrypt(self._password).strip()
+
+    @property
+    def username(self):
+        """Get the current username."""
+        enc = CryptoEngine.get()
+        return enc.decrypt(self._username).strip()
+
+    @username.setter
+    def username(self, value):
+        """Set the username."""
+        enc = CryptoEngine.get()
+        self._username = enc.encrypt(value).strip()
+
+    @password.setter
+    def password(self, value):
+        """Set the Notes."""
+        enc = CryptoEngine.get()
+        self._password = enc.encrypt(value).strip()
+
+    @property
+    def tags(self):
+        enc = CryptoEngine.get()
+        try:
+            return [enc.decrypt(tag) for tag in filter(None, self._tags)]
+        except Exception:
+            return [tag for tag in filter(None, self._tags)]
+
+    @tags.setter
+    def tags(self, value):
+        self._tags = [tag for tag in value]
+
+    @property
+    def url(self):
+        """Get the current url."""
+        enc = CryptoEngine.get()
+        return enc.decrypt(self._url).strip()
+
+    @url.setter
+    def url(self, value):
+        """Set the Notes."""
+        enc = CryptoEngine.get()
+        self._url = enc.encrypt(value).strip()
+
+    @property
+    def notes(self):
+        """Get the current notes."""
+        enc = CryptoEngine.get()
+        return enc.decrypt(self._notes).strip()
+
+    @notes.setter
+    def notes(self, value):
+        """Set the Notes."""
+        enc = CryptoEngine.get()
+        self._notes = enc.encrypt(value).strip()
